Allwinner T113-i industrial gateway supports Ethernet, WiFi, Bluetooth, 4G LTE, offers RS232, RS485, CAN Bus, DI/DO interfaces

MYiR Tech’s MY-EVC700S-V2 is an industrial gateway powered by Allwinner T113-i dual-core Cortex-A7 microprocessor (MPU), and equipped with up to 512MB DDR3, 4GB eMMC flash, and 32KB EEPROM.

The fanless industrial-grade gateway offers RS232, RS485, CAN Bus, DO, and DI through terminal blocks, Fast Ethernet, WiFi, Bluetooth, and 4GB LTE connectivity, HDMI and LVDS display interfaces, a few USB ports, and more.

MY-EVC700S-V2 specifications:

  • SoC – Allwinner T113-i
    • CPU
      • Dual-core Arm Cortex-A7 clocked at up to 1.2 GHz
      • 64-bit XuanTie C906 RISC-V real-time core
    • DSP – HiFi4
    • VPU
      • Video decoder – H.265 up to 4K @ 30 FPS, H.264 up to 4K @ 24 FPS, MPEG-1/2/4, JPEG, Xvid, Sorenson Spark up to 1080p60
      • Video encoder – JPEG/MJPEG up to 1080p60
    • Package – LFBGA 337 balls, 13 x 13 mm
  • System Memory – 512MB DDR3
  • Storage
    • 4GB eMMC flash
    • 32KB EEPROM
    • MicroSD card slot
  • Display Interfaces
    • LVDS-to-HDMI interface (optional)
    • LVDS connector (that looks like a DVI connector)
  • Audio – 3.5mm audio jack
  • Networking
    • 10/100Mbps Ethernet RJ45 port
    • WiFi/Bluetooth module
    • USB-based 4G LTE mini PCIe module (Quectel EC200MCNLF-I03-MN0CA)
    • 2x antenna connectors, one for WiFi/Bluetooth, one for 4G LTE
  • USB – 2x USB 2.0 host ports
  • I/Os via terminal blocks – 2x RS232, 2x isolated RS485, 2x isolated CAN, 2x DI, 2x DO
  • Debugging – USB-C debug connector (for serial console, I assume)
  • Misc
    • Reset button
    • 4x LEDs (PWR, ERR, RUN, 4G)
    • RTC
  • Power Supply – 9V to 15V DC via 3-pin terminal block (Rated voltage: 12V DC)
  • Dimensions – 194 x 158 x 32.5mm (metal enclosure)
  • Temperature Range – -40°C to +85°C
  • Certifications – CE certified

The Allwinner T113-i industrial gateway ships with a customized Linux image. MYiR provides a Linux BSP for the gateway with source code for u-boot 2018.05, Linux kernel 5.4.61 (end of life in December 2025), and hardware drivers. As usual, the BSP is not public, and only offered to customers.

As I started writing this article, I was convinced we had already covered the Allwinner T113-i a few times, but I was wrong, and instead we wrote about the similar Allwinner T113-S3 MPU, the 100ASK-T113-Pro industrial SBC, and MYiR MYC-YT113X low-cost CPU module. Allwinner provides a product brief for the “i” variant, and Forlinx wrote an article comparing the Allwinner T113-S3 and T113-i SoCs while introducing the company’s FET113i-S system-on-module. Basically, the T113-i supports up to 2GB external RAM (instead of 128MB on-chip), can operate in the industrial temperature range (-40°C to +85°C), adds a real-time RISC-V slave core, and packages are also different (T113-i is LFPGA, T113-S3 is TQFP).

MYiR Tech sells for MY-EVC700S-V2 gateway for $129. You’ll find more information and a purchase link on the product page.

  1. The T113-S(2/3/4), D1-H, D1-S/F133, and T113-i seem to have the same die. T113-S has Arm cores and DSP, D1-H has the RISC-V core and DSP, D1-H/F133 have only the RISC-V core, and this has the Arm cores, RISC-V core, and DSP.
